A mixture of weak acid and its salt is
Correct answer: B. Acidic buffer
- A. Alkaline buffer
- B. Acidic buffer
- C. Neutral buffer
- D. All of the above
Explanation
An acidic buffer is a solution that consists of a weak acid and its salt, which helps to maintain a stable pH level when small amounts of acid or base are added. This is the correct answer because the mixture described in the question specifically forms an acidic buffer. An alkaline buffer, on the other hand, consists of a weak base and its salt, not a weak acid. A neutral buffer is not typically created from a weak acid and its salt, as these combinations generally result in an acidic buffer. Therefore, option D 'All of the above' is incorrect because only the acidic buffer option accurately describes the given mixture.
